{"work":{"id":"7f89ae26-7a6c-40db-a996-38815f00ce42","openalex_id":null,"doi":null,"arxiv_id":"2302.06590","raw_key":null,"title":"The Impact of AI on Developer Productivity: Evidence from GitHub Copilot","authors":null,"authors_text":"S","year":2023,"venue":"cs.SE","abstract":"Generative AI tools hold promise to increase human productivity. This paper presents results from a controlled experiment with GitHub Copilot, an AI pair programmer. Recruited software developers were asked to implement an HTTP server in JavaScript as quickly as possible. The treatment group, with access to the AI pair programmer, completed the task 55.8% faster than the control group. Observed heterogenous effects show promise for AI pair programmers to help people transition into software development careers.","external_url":"https://arxiv.org/abs/2302.06590","cited_by_count":null,"metadata_source":"pith","metadata_fetched_at":"2026-05-14T18:57:50.043171+00:00","pith_arxiv_id":"2302.06590","created_at":"2026-05-08T18:08:53.196576+00:00","updated_at":"2026-05-14T18:57:50.043171+00:00","title_quality_ok":true,"display_title":"The Impact of AI on Developer Productivity: Evidence from GitHub Copilot","render_title":"The Impact of AI on Developer Productivity: Evidence from GitHub Copilot"},"hub":{"state":{"work_id":"7f89ae26-7a6c-40db-a996-38815f00ce42","tier":"hub","tier_reason":"10+ Pith inbound or 1,000+ external citations","pith_inbound_count":33,"external_cited_by_count":null,"distinct_field_count":7,"first_pith_cited_at":"2023-03-15T17:15:04+00:00","last_pith_cited_at":"2026-05-13T13:46:12+00:00","author_build_status":"not_needed","summary_status":"needed","contexts_status":"needed","graph_status":"needed","ask_index_status":"not_needed","reader_status":"not_needed","recognition_status":"not_needed","updated_at":"2026-05-14T20:46:11.772051+00:00","tier_text":"hub"},"tier":"hub","role_counts":[],"polarity_counts":[],"runs":{"context_extract":{"job_type":"context_extract","status":"succeeded","result":{"enqueued_papers":25},"error":null,"updated_at":"2026-05-14T18:20:23.085681+00:00"},"graph_features":{"job_type":"graph_features","status":"succeeded","result":{"co_cited":[{"title":"Evaluating Large Language Models Trained on Code","work_id":"042493e9-b26f-4b4e-bbde-382072ca9b08","shared_citers":12},{"title":"Program Synthesis with Large Language Models","work_id":"fd241a05-03b9-4de2-9588-9d77ce176125","shared_citers":7},{"title":"DeepSeek-Coder: When the Large Language Model Meets Programming -- The Rise of Code Intelligence","work_id":"f22dae5a-27e2-41d0-a061-c4286418dee3","shared_citers":6},{"title":"Code Llama: Open Foundation Models for Code","work_id":"e73bffa4-7620-47ac-9327-259a60db52ca","shared_citers":5},{"title":"Qwen2.5-Coder Technical Report","work_id":"09ba463d-6377-4017-9801-444ffb94b056","shared_citers":5},{"title":"Measuring the impact of early-2025 AI on experienced open-source developer productivity.CoRR, abs/2507.09089","work_id":"5cc62c11-dd1e-43cc-83ff-88186859b97d","shared_citers":4},{"title":"SWE-bench: Can Language Models Resolve Real-World GitHub Issues?","work_id":"d0effe15-a689-441a-8e3f-ea35f1c4e4b1","shared_citers":4},{"title":"Agentless: Demystifying LLM-based Software Engineering Agents","work_id":"71c901c4-3c83-4e10-af54-3daef7fff397","shared_citers":3},{"title":"AutoGen: Enabling Next-Gen LLM Applications via Multi-Agent Conversation","work_id":"92b7eb9c-c3d8-4518-a376-06fa15dd895b","shared_citers":3},{"title":"Grounded Copilot: How Programmers Interact with Code-Generating Models","work_id":"51405e44-d448-481a-926c-6eff2534f04a","shared_citers":3},{"title":"LiveCodeBench: Holistic and Contamination Free Evaluation of Large Language Models for Code","work_id":"ea9e51ce-1e75-4182-92d8-4d25f70d2ee4","shared_citers":3},{"title":"StarCoder 2 and The Stack v2: The Next Generation","work_id":"2495cc72-f326-4c23-8a39-d9a08cf583e4","shared_citers":3},{"title":"2025 , issue_date =","work_id":"0caaec0f-69fb-4b25-add7-217ae6f62d51","shared_citers":2},{"title":"arXiv:2308.10620 [cs.SE]","work_id":"95a41a91-71b5-4995-9900-0c80aa0d96a6","shared_citers":2},{"title":"Bauer et al","work_id":"0d9fa1d8-3798-460e-b7d0-2b6b796ba658","shared_citers":2},{"title":"DeepSeek-V3.2: Pushing the Frontier of Open Large Language Models","work_id":"07c85cc5-4086-4abc-823b-6d0f4ff784d0","shared_citers":2},{"title":"Do users write more insecure code with AI assistants?","work_id":"524c0f5a-3c09-480d-8adb-8d7c1bb974c1","shared_citers":2},{"title":"Efficient training of language models to fill in the middle","work_id":"54afe4f8-4d93-4829-99ae-2a27143a9641","shared_citers":2},{"title":"Experience: Evaluating the Usability of Code Generation Tools Powered by Large Language Models","work_id":"c2ff4125-db10-4c48-84b9-69b445e4dcd6","shared_citers":2},{"title":"& Gerosa, M","work_id":"0d7beab3-03de-45f7-80ca-0a018e46e7c3","shared_citers":2},{"title":"GPT-4 Technical Report","work_id":"b928e041-6991-4c08-8c81-0359e4097c7b","shared_citers":2},{"title":"How ai impacts skill formation.arXiv preprint arXiv:2601.20245","work_id":"a49bed73-cefd-4918-a7a4-cc987475a3a0","shared_citers":2},{"title":"Is Your Code Generated by ChatGPT Really Correct? Rigorous Evaluation of Large Language Models for Code Generation","work_id":"87dbe8ba-8890-4902-b093-990f456a6b2a","shared_citers":2},{"title":"Liu et al","work_id":"69c08530-7ca4-4857-bf1c-414aafc9e564","shared_citers":2}],"time_series":[{"n":1,"year":2023},{"n":1,"year":2024},{"n":30,"year":2026}],"dependency_candidates":[]},"error":null,"updated_at":"2026-05-14T18:20:19.221895+00:00"},"identity_refresh":{"job_type":"identity_refresh","status":"succeeded","result":{"items":[{"title":"Qwen3 Technical Report","outcome":"unchanged","work_id":"25a4e30c-1232-48e7-9925-02fa12ba7c9e","resolver":"local_arxiv","confidence":0.98,"old_work_id":"25a4e30c-1232-48e7-9925-02fa12ba7c9e"}],"counts":{"fixed":0,"merged":0,"unchanged":1,"quarantined":0,"needs_external_resolution":0},"errors":[],"attempted":1},"error":null,"updated_at":"2026-05-14T18:19:42.739797+00:00"},"summary_claims":{"job_type":"summary_claims","status":"succeeded","result":{"title":"The Impact of AI on Developer Productivity: Evidence from GitHub Copilot","claims":[{"claim_text":"Generative AI tools hold promise to increase human productivity. This paper presents results from a controlled experiment with GitHub Copilot, an AI pair programmer. Recruited software developers were asked to implement an HTTP server in JavaScript as quickly as possible. The treatment group, with access to the AI pair programmer, completed the task 55.8% faster than the control group. Observed heterogenous effects show promise for AI pair programmers to help people transition into software development careers.","claim_type":"abstract","evidence_strength":"source_metadata"}],"why_cited":"Pith tracks The Impact of AI on Developer Productivity: Evidence from GitHub Copilot because it crossed a citation-hub threshold.","role_counts":[]},"error":null,"updated_at":"2026-05-14T18:19:58.198649+00:00"}},"summary":{"title":"The Impact of AI on Developer Productivity: Evidence from GitHub Copilot","claims":[{"claim_text":"Generative AI tools hold promise to increase human productivity. This paper presents results from a controlled experiment with GitHub Copilot, an AI pair programmer. Recruited software developers were asked to implement an HTTP server in JavaScript as quickly as possible. The treatment group, with access to the AI pair programmer, completed the task 55.8% faster than the control group. Observed heterogenous effects show promise for AI pair programmers to help people transition into software development careers.","claim_type":"abstract","evidence_strength":"source_metadata"}],"why_cited":"Pith tracks The Impact of AI on Developer Productivity: Evidence from GitHub Copilot because it crossed a citation-hub threshold.","role_counts":[]},"graph":{"co_cited":[{"title":"Evaluating Large Language Models Trained on Code","work_id":"042493e9-b26f-4b4e-bbde-382072ca9b08","shared_citers":12},{"title":"Program Synthesis with Large Language Models","work_id":"fd241a05-03b9-4de2-9588-9d77ce176125","shared_citers":7},{"title":"DeepSeek-Coder: When the Large Language Model Meets Programming -- The Rise of Code Intelligence","work_id":"f22dae5a-27e2-41d0-a061-c4286418dee3","shared_citers":6},{"title":"Code Llama: Open Foundation Models for Code","work_id":"e73bffa4-7620-47ac-9327-259a60db52ca","shared_citers":5},{"title":"Qwen2.5-Coder Technical Report","work_id":"09ba463d-6377-4017-9801-444ffb94b056","shared_citers":5},{"title":"Measuring the impact of early-2025 AI on experienced open-source developer productivity.CoRR, abs/2507.09089","work_id":"5cc62c11-dd1e-43cc-83ff-88186859b97d","shared_citers":4},{"title":"SWE-bench: Can Language Models Resolve Real-World GitHub Issues?","work_id":"d0effe15-a689-441a-8e3f-ea35f1c4e4b1","shared_citers":4},{"title":"Agentless: Demystifying LLM-based Software Engineering Agents","work_id":"71c901c4-3c83-4e10-af54-3daef7fff397","shared_citers":3},{"title":"AutoGen: Enabling Next-Gen LLM Applications via Multi-Agent Conversation","work_id":"92b7eb9c-c3d8-4518-a376-06fa15dd895b","shared_citers":3},{"title":"Grounded Copilot: How Programmers Interact with Code-Generating Models","work_id":"51405e44-d448-481a-926c-6eff2534f04a","shared_citers":3},{"title":"LiveCodeBench: Holistic and Contamination Free Evaluation of Large Language Models for Code","work_id":"ea9e51ce-1e75-4182-92d8-4d25f70d2ee4","shared_citers":3},{"title":"StarCoder 2 and The Stack v2: The Next Generation","work_id":"2495cc72-f326-4c23-8a39-d9a08cf583e4","shared_citers":3},{"title":"2025 , issue_date =","work_id":"0caaec0f-69fb-4b25-add7-217ae6f62d51","shared_citers":2},{"title":"arXiv:2308.10620 [cs.SE]","work_id":"95a41a91-71b5-4995-9900-0c80aa0d96a6","shared_citers":2},{"title":"Bauer et al","work_id":"0d9fa1d8-3798-460e-b7d0-2b6b796ba658","shared_citers":2},{"title":"DeepSeek-V3.2: Pushing the Frontier of Open Large Language Models","work_id":"07c85cc5-4086-4abc-823b-6d0f4ff784d0","shared_citers":2},{"title":"Do users write more insecure code with AI assistants?","work_id":"524c0f5a-3c09-480d-8adb-8d7c1bb974c1","shared_citers":2},{"title":"Efficient training of language models to fill in the middle","work_id":"54afe4f8-4d93-4829-99ae-2a27143a9641","shared_citers":2},{"title":"Experience: Evaluating the Usability of Code Generation Tools Powered by Large Language Models","work_id":"c2ff4125-db10-4c48-84b9-69b445e4dcd6","shared_citers":2},{"title":"& Gerosa, M","work_id":"0d7beab3-03de-45f7-80ca-0a018e46e7c3","shared_citers":2},{"title":"GPT-4 Technical Report","work_id":"b928e041-6991-4c08-8c81-0359e4097c7b","shared_citers":2},{"title":"How ai impacts skill formation.arXiv preprint arXiv:2601.20245","work_id":"a49bed73-cefd-4918-a7a4-cc987475a3a0","shared_citers":2},{"title":"Is Your Code Generated by ChatGPT Really Correct? Rigorous Evaluation of Large Language Models for Code Generation","work_id":"87dbe8ba-8890-4902-b093-990f456a6b2a","shared_citers":2},{"title":"Liu et al","work_id":"69c08530-7ca4-4857-bf1c-414aafc9e564","shared_citers":2}],"time_series":[{"n":1,"year":2023},{"n":1,"year":2024},{"n":30,"year":2026}],"dependency_candidates":[]},"authors":[]}}